Error en Magento 1.4.1.1
Invalid entity supplied: Mage_Sales_Model_Mysql4_Order_Address
Hoy he instalado Magento 1.4.1.1 y en proceso de checkout, al momento de comprar sale el siguiente error: Invalid entity supplied: Mage_Sales_Model_Mysql4_Order_Address y una ventana enorme con un código. La solución después de horas de tratar de entender que era lo malo… hice lo siguiente:
1.- Reemplace app/code/core/Mage/Sales/Model/Mysql4/Order/ por la carpeta Order de Magento 1.4.1.0 o sea, la ubicación de app/code/core/Mage/Sales/Model/Mysql4/Order/ de Magento 1.4.1.0 bueno así funcionó.
2.- Debemos esperar que Magento arregle este error y volver actualizarlo cuando salga la versión 1.4.2
3.- Acá dejó una versión corregida de Magento llamada magento-1.4.2.0-beta1 la cual pueden bajar desde aquí: http://www.magentochile.cl/backup/magento-1.4.2.0-beta1.tar.gz
o pueden instalar vía ssh así:
wget http://www.magentochile.cl/backup/magento-1.4.2.0-beta1.tar.gz
tar -zxvf magento-1.4.2.0-beta1.tar.gz
mv magento/* magento/.htaccess .
chmod o+w var var/.htaccess app/etc
chmod -R o+w media
./pear mage-setup .
rm -rf downloader/pearlib/cache/* downloader/pearlib/download/*
rm -rf magento/magento-1.4.2.0-beta1.tar.gz
Para los permisos
find . -type d -exec chmod 777 {} \;
4.- Solución definitiva para Magento 1.4.1.1 Magento a publicado su parche (era lo que se había previsto…la misma ruta del directorio expuesta más arriba), lo pueden bajar aquí: http://www.magentochile.cl/backup/1.4.1.1.sales.fix.zip
5.- Magento ya tiene todo solucionado y pueden bajar e instalar traquilamente la versión 1.4.1.1 desde el sitio oficial
Atte
Boris D.
Magento Chile Google+